Understanding Truck Skid Plates: Their Role and Benefits for Brownsville Tx Fleet Operations
Truck skid plates, also known as underbody protection, are an essential component for any commercial vehicle, especially those operating in challenging terrain or urban environments like Brownsville, TX. These plates serve a dual purpose: they protect the truck’s vulnerable underbelly from debris, rocks, and other potential hazards that can cause costly damage during fleet operations. By deflecting these objects away from the vehicle, skid plates reduce the risk of sidewall cuts, tire punctures, and even more severe steering repairs in Brownsville Tx fleets.
Beyond protection, skid plates offer significant advantages for truck maintenance and longevity. They help prevent underbody corrosion, which is a common issue in regions with high humidity levels. By shielding the vehicle’s framework, these plates contribute to better overall fleet management by reducing the frequency of unexpected breakdowns, including those related to steering systems. This translates into cost savings through decreased downtime and lower repair bills for Brownsville Tx fleet operations.
Choosing the Right Skid Plate: Considerations for Fleet Managers in Brownsville Tx
When it comes to protecting your fleet in Brownsville, TX, from underbody damage, choosing the right skid plate is essential. Fleet managers should consider factors like terrain and road conditions, vehicle weight, and typical cargo types when selecting a skid plate. For instance, if your fleet often navigates rough or uneven terrain, a heavier-duty skid plate capable of withstanding impacts and debris is crucial for long-term protection.
Additionally, ensuring compatibility with your trucks’ steering repair systems and overall vehicle design is paramount to avoid any potential interference. Local mechanics in Brownsville, TX, can provide valuable insights into the specific needs of your fleet, recommending plates that balance protection, weight, and performance for optimal results.
Maintaining and Repairing Truck Skid Plates: Ensuring Optimal Performance for Brownsville Tx Fleets
Brownsville, Tx fleets rely on their trucks to get the job done, and maintaining optimal performance is key. One often-overlooked component in achieving this are truck skid plates. Over time, these plates can become damaged from rough terrain, debris, and normal wear and tear, impacting steering stability and overall vehicle safety. Regular inspection is crucial for identifying any cracks, dents, or misalignments that require immediate repair.
Skid plate repairs should be handled by qualified professionals to ensure precision and longevity.
